WitrynaIMPORTED targets are used to convert files outside of a CMake project into logical targets inside of the project. IMPORTED targets are created using the IMPORTED option of the add_executable () and add_library () commands. No build files are generated for IMPORTED targets. Witryna23 lip 2024 · while ~feof (readFileId) fileData = fread (readFileId, buffersize, '*uint8'); writeCount = fwrite (writeFileId, fileData, 'uint8'); end. fclose (readFileId); fclose (writeFileId); The larger the buffer size that you use, the more efficient the I/O is.
